Beth Racette says, "I grew up under a vast Kansas sky, climbing trees, watching for tornados, and playing with ant farms and thousands of baby toads."


With a childhood connection to the natural world, it's no surprise her recent artwork explores the Gaia Theory - a theory that the Earth is a complex, living, self-regulating system with the capacity to maintain condition for life. Her book GAIA is a collection of her work portraying the many systems and aspects of the Earth. "Water Planet" is one in the series.


Also included is a copy of her book GAIA with images of the works in the series.
